String Studio VS-1

The String Studio VS-1 synthesizer swaps the traditional oscillator, filter, and envelope pattern for real-life string instrument components. At the core of String Studio lies a new cutting edge string model interacting with picks, bows, hammers, fingers, frets, dampers, and soundboards. Through this direct approach, String Studio delivers stunning guitars, basses, harps, clavinets, bowed instruments, percussions as well as rich and animated tones that blend the warmth, naturalness, and density of real-life with unique and innovative timbres from yet unheard instruments.

The Unmistakable Feeling of Playing a Real Instrument

Once again, AAS brings you the state-of-the-art in physical modeling for unmatched sound quality and realism. Instead of relying on samples and wavetables, String Studio generates sound on the fly using an accurate model of the components and interactions involved in string instruments. This elaborate synthesis engine responds dynamically depending on your performance and how it is already vibrating, producing sound that is always unique to the moment. As a result of its nature, String Studio captures the richness and diversity of acoustic textures and reproduces the quirks, subtleties, and responsiveness of real-life instruments. This is the key to providing you with vibrant sound as well as the presence and expressivity of a real instrument.

Physical Ergonomics

The String Studio interface is conveniently laid out around components of a string instrument and the controls are directly related to their physical properties. With just a limited number of intuitive parameters, String Studio procures a remarkable range of sounds. Explore the extensive collection of warm and organic sounds included with String Studio or tweak and create exquisite textures simply not possible with other synthesizers.

Live Extras

Finally, String Studio offers premium performance features, including keyboard modes, portamento, vibrato and legato functions as well as a programmable pattern arpeggiator. For optimal controller integration, String Studio features a complete set of MIDI features; easy-to-use ‘MIDI Learn’ function for user defined MIDI maps, min/max parameter range settings, MIDI program change and automation. A high quality effect rack, featuring distortion, chorus, delay and reverb completes the package.

Features:

  • Entirely based on physical modeling for outstanding sound quality
  • Top quality preset library
  • Real time calculation of sound - no samples
  • 32bit floating point internal processing
  • Audio bit-depth and sample rates up to 24bit/192kHz
  • Integrated audio recorder to capture performance on the fly
  • Integrated browser and locate function for easy navigation and organization of presets
  • Import/Export functions for easy sharing of presets
  • Unlimited undo/redo capability
  • Standalone operation - no host application required
  • Standard plugin formats support
  • Full audio and MIDI hardware support
  • Simultaneous operation of multiple MIDI ports
  • MIDI automation and program change support
  • User defined MIDI maps with MIDI Learn
  • High quality integrated master effects: chorus, delay and reverb
  • MIDI Clock, tap and host tempo synchronization
  • Dynamic voice allocation and CPU overhead protection
